Want to include Barcode number in an item configuration package

(0) ShareShare
ReportReport
Posted on by

hello, 

i have created a configuration package for the table ITEM, in order to import/export more rapidly from excel.

I managed to include all the fields i want: number, description, vendor number etc..

Except the Barcode number, which is not apparently a field in the table??

How can i find this field to include it in my configuration package? apparently i can't find it, also, how can i make it in a way that when i import from the excel list i made, to include barcode?

    "Bar Codes" are stored in Table 5717 Item Cross References.  This allows you to have different Bar Codes depending on the Unit of Measure.  You may have one for PCS for instance and another barcode for PACK.

    You'll need to populate Item No., Cross-Reference Type = "Bar Code", Unit of Measure (e.g. "PCS") and Cross-Reference No. (with the actual barcode) at least.

    The fields I mention are all *relevant*.  When "Cross-Reference Type" is set to "Bar Code" then Cross-Reference No. is intended to be exactly that.  The same table can be used for other Cross-References, i.e. if your Customers and/or Vendors have a different code for one of your items you can record that here by setting Cross-Reference Type appropriately.  I can't think of anywhere in NAV Bar Codes are specifically used in any standard reports or pages but you would be able to pull it onto reports yourself or, for instance, retrieve it through Bar Code software such as BarTender.

    There is no Barcode field as such, it is a separate table as a Cross-Reference functionality. Please refer here:

    Suppose you're filling an Item card in Nav, you filled description, item number etc.. and filled Barcode No. as 138494 let's say.

    Where is the barcode number stored in the DB? It must be stored somewhere!

  • The Simpsoid Profile Picture
    625 on at

    Only in related table 5717 although there is field number 1217 GTIN on the Item Card in NAV 2016 (I believe) and newer.
